The Journal of the Physical Society of Japan (JPSJ) is published by the Physical Society of Japan (JPS) . It is devoted to the rapid dissemination of important research results in all fields of physics from condensed matter physics to particle physics. Since its launch in 1946 as the successor to the well-known Proceedings of the Physico-Mathematical Society of Japan, JPSJ has published many important papers and has attained a worldwide reputation.
